MBACC Story Slam: Strange Bedfellows 2/19
"Story Slams are about coming together and sharing a chat by the fireside. It builds community." - Daniel Barkowitz
Mother Brook Arts & Community Center continues its Story Slam series on Thursday, February 19, 2015 at 7:00 pm. The theme is “Strange Bedfellows” and will be hosted by Daniel T. Barkowitz, Dedham Resident.
Come and share your true five minute (or less) story with the audience and a panel of judges. Rather sit back and watch the events unravel? Listeners have an opportunity to participate in storytelling games and vote in an audience choice ballot.
On the night of the slam, competitors drop their name in a hat and are chosen at random to compete against other tellers for prizes. $100.00 dollars in cash prizes will be awarded to the top storytellers of the evening. There is a cash bar and free parking.

This slam will benefit Mother Brook Arts & Community Center. Tickets are $10.00 online (www.motherbrookarts.org/story-slam) and $15.00 at the door.
MBACC hosts a story slam on the third Thursday of each month. The next three slam dates are:

February 19: Strange Bedfellows
March 19: Some Day We’ll Laugh About This
April 16: Road Trip
